Knights of the Golden Horseshoe Escape Room

Coming Mid-June 2024!

This escape room is based on an expedition of about 50 men that Alexander Spotswood (acting Royal Governor of Virginia) lead in 1716 into the Shenandoah Valley. This was one of the first exploratory expeditions into the Shenandoah Valley by the colonists. The journalist of this expedition was a Huguenot, Lieut. John Fontaine, who served as an officer in the British Army. On September 6, 1716, they rode down into the Shenandoah Valley on the east side of Massanutten Mountain and reached the Shenandoah River, which they called the "Euphrates" near the current town of Elkton.

After the journey, Spotswood gave each officer of the expedition a stickpin made of gold and shaped like a horseshoe on which he had inscribed the words in Latin "Sic juvat transcendere montes", which translates into English as "Thus, it is pleasant to cross the mountains."[4] The horseshoes were encrusted with small stones and were small enough to be worn from a watch chain.[5] The members of Governor Spotswood's expedition soon became popularly known as the "Knights of the Golden Horseshoe."
